二分法求方程的解

举报

发布于:2022-11-06

更新于:2022-11-06

0

538

大山的情怀

0M/ 0.1M

作品介绍:

问题:二分法求方程x^3-2x-1=0的近似解,精度为0.0000 01

操作说明:

寻找两个值a和b,使得函数值异号 vb程序转化方法 Sub 二分法() a = 0 b = 5 p = 0.00001 Do Midl = (a + b) / 2 If f(Midl) = 0 Then Exit Do Else If f(Midl) &#62 0 Then b = Midl Else a = Midl End If End If Loop While b - a &#62 p Cells(3, 2) = "方程的根是" & (a + b) / 2 Cells(3, 3) = (a + b) / 2 End Sub Private Function f(ByVal x As Single) As Single f = x ^ 3 - 2 * x - 1 End Function

收藏